I have installed Asana for Salesforce into Salesforce for all users. The version is 1.16 for the AsanaPublic app. I am able to log into Asana through Asana Settings within Salesforce, but none of my users can get the Asana log in auth page to pop-up. Instead they get an error of:
There is no setting for category “auth” with name “ClientId”
Error is in expression ‘{!generateAsanaAuthPageRef}’ in page asanapublic:auth: (AsanaPublic)
I have uninstalled Asana for Salesforce from Salesforce, wiping all of the data. I then re-installed Asana for Salesforce, making sure that I specified that I wanted the app to install for all users. Once again, I am fine but my regular users are not. I’m the Salesforce admin for my company and I think that there is probably a rights or access issue. Does anyone have something that I can try to get Asana for Salesforce to allow Salesforce users to connect to their Asana account?
